Output f6338014fc48b1c6d4d9a5908781f6dc91e103d5eebdd92b17e9b89f751dde40:1

value
27324869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f304ef9db04111a86e9982245f0504c9504b0be OP_EQUAL
address
M9HUEqjc5R8QyWBjKzSS6vAFdjf1mvxuKb
transaction
f6338014fc48b1c6d4d9a5908781f6dc91e103d5eebdd92b17e9b89f751dde40
spent
true